On Sunday, a man accused of dumping a dog in a Walgreen’s parking lot in San Fernando on Christmas Eve says he was just trying to help.  The animal looked dirty and matted, uncared for in a while, and in need of a meal.

The man says he was simply trying to stop the dog getting hit by a car.  He says he saw the dog moving in and out of traffic.  He figured he would grab the dog and get him off of the road, bringing him to the nearby parking lot.

On Wednesday, a couple feeding stray cats came across the dog and managed to get a handle on him.  At around 9:50pm, he was given over to independent animal rescuer Hailey Moss.

The dog has been dubbed Ralphie.  Ralphie is staying with a short term foster family, and has had a grooming, and of course, a good meal.

It’s believed that Ralphie is a shih tzu and Lhasa apso mix.  There has been a YouCaring.com page set up for Ralphie, which you can visit by clicking here.
